*Pimp my PC*
Posted by Robert Lambie on December 23, 2005 at 6:48 pmNot exactly signs, but good fun none the less…
the following is a computer andrew has bought for his wee girl for xmas.
she wanted something pink and loves the cartoons that are featured below. having searched high and low for a pink PC and the like he gave up after only being able to locate pink mice and keyboards.
so plan B came into swing….strip down the pc
rub down, etch, spray paint & laquer it pink!
rebuild it
digital print the images from stuff located on the net
apply images & some cut vinyl text…im sure she will love it… 😀
